some of this observations could be a physical property (the one can be collected by the senses) or a chemical property (the one that can be collected by experience):

1.- It has a certain color.

2.- It has a definite shape.

3.- It has length.

4.- It has width.

5.- Is a solid body.

6.- Has a certain odor.

7.- It feels slippery.

8.- It has a definitive weight.

9.- It has a definite volume.

10.- It posses a certain density.

11.- It tastes waxy.

12.- It burns with help of the candlewick.

13.- It emits heat when it burns.

14.- The flame has a certain color.

15.- The flame has a certain temperature.

16.- It reacts with the air to start combustion.

17.- It changes the state of matter from solid to liquid.

18.- The flame emitted light.

19.- The flame changes color.

20.- The flame can attract smoke from another burning source.

21.- The flame change its longitude by passing the time.

22.- The size change trough the time.

23.- The volume change trough the time.

24.- The wax can not be dissolved in water.

25.- The wax can be dissolved in organic solvents.

26.- The light of the flame could change trough the time.

27.- The flame can emitted a black smoke.

28.- The candle can pass heat to the surface that is in contact.

29.- The candle when it burns emitted a sound.

30.- The candle can be reflect in another surface producing some shades.
